Overview of Member Services Representative

A Member Services Representative is a professional who is responsible for managing and maintaining relationships with members of an organization. They are often the first point of contact for members, handling inquiries, resolving issues, and providing information about the organization's services and benefits. The role requires excellent communication skills, both verbal and written, as well as the ability to work well under pressure and handle multiple tasks simultaneously.

Member Services Representatives are also responsible for processing membership applications, renewals, and cancellations, as well as updating member records and ensuring that all information is accurate and up-to-date. They may also be responsible for conducting outreach and engagement activities, such as organizing events or sending out newsletters, to keep members informed and engaged with the organization.

About Member Services Representative Resume

A Member Services Representative resume should highlight the candidate's experience in customer service, as well as their ability to manage and maintain relationships with members. The resume should also emphasize the candidate's communication skills, both verbal and written, as well as their ability to work well under pressure and handle multiple tasks simultaneously. It is important to include any relevant experience in membership management, such as processing applications, renewals, and cancellations, as well as updating member records and ensuring accuracy.

In addition to experience, the resume should also highlight any relevant education or training, such as a degree in business administration or a related field, or certification in customer service or membership management. The resume should also include any relevant skills, such as proficiency in CRM software or other membership management tools, as well as any language skills that may be relevant to the position.
